Soraya Haddad (born 30 September 1984) is an Algerian judoka. She won abronze medal in the ‍–‍52 kg weight class at the 2008 Summer Olympics. She has been the African champion five times: 2004, 2005, 2008, 2011 and 2012, and also a bronze medalist in the ‍–‍48 kg category in the 2005 World Championships in Egypt. Read more on Wikipedia
